The Master of International Management with a specialization in Sports Management gives students a 360-degree perspective of the sports industry, including the media, technological advances, and event planning. Students make key connections, attend the industry’s top events, and graduate ready to take on the sports industry. On this course, you will:
· Develop the communication and technical skills required to become an effective industry professional
· Gain insight into practical business planning and management
· Learn how to efficiently plan sporting events
· Manage team organization, merchandising, and marketing

Duration: 1.5 years / 3 semesters
Credits: 90 ECTS
Language: English
Delivery mode: On-campus


Fees
Barcelona & Madrid
Application Fee: EUR 150 (non-refundable, paid upon application)
Administration Fee: EUR 1,900 (one-time fee, 80% refund if the entry visa or residence permit is refused by the visa authorities)
Tuition per semester: EUR 5,450 (1.5-year / 3-semester program) (100% refund if the entry visa or residence permit is refused by the visa authorities

Geneva
Application Fee: EUR 150 (non-refundable, paid upon application)
Administration Fee: CHF 3,000 (one-time fee, 80% refund if the entry visa or residence permit is refused by the visa authorities)
Tuition per semester: CHF 10,250 (1.5-year / 3-semester program) (100% refund if the entry visa or residence permit is refused by the visa authorities)

ADMISSIONS REQUIREMENTS FOR MASTER

- Bachelor’s degree or equivalent, preferably in a related field
- IELTS 6.5 / TOEFL 74 / DET 105-110 (official English exam results) or proof of studying previously in an English-speaking environment for a minimum of 3 years
- A scanned copy of all required academic diplomas, transcripts, and academic certificates- A 500-word written response to a business case study
- An interview with a representative from the academic team on their chosen campus. Their response to the case study will be discussed in the interview.
- Photocopy of a valid passport / national ID
- Resume/CV
- 1 reference letter from a former teacher or employer
